Located in the Everett School District at 30 Dartmouth St in Everett, MA, Webster School serves grades PK-3 & ungraded and has an enrollment of roughly 532 students. Frequently Asked Questions about Everett
How much are Studio apartments in Everett?
There are currently 746 Studio Apartments in Everett with rent ranges from $1,250 to $7,220 with an average price of $2,604.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Everett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Everett ranges from $1,000 to $26,353 with an average monthly rent of $3,050.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Everett c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Everett range from $920 to $17,635.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$3,682.
How expensive are Everett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 605 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Everett on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$850 to $14,976 - averaging $4,176 for the location.
